KENNY WELCOMES COMPLETION OF NABCO REFURBISHMENT OF GREENLAWNS IN COOLOCK

Posted on August 19, 2013 1:56 PM   |   Permanent Link   

Dublin Bay North Labour TD has welcomed the completion of refurbishment works of Ireland's first co-operative housing rental scheme of Greenlawns in Coolock.

"I am delighted that a significant redevelopment and refurbishment of the estate by the National Association of Building Co-operatives (Nabco) has just been completed at a cost of €1.5 million. The work saw the original 17 houses being refurbished with new kitchens and bathrooms, new windows and doors and the upgrading of existing heating and electrical services. The shared central courtyard was also landscaped."

"The development also included the provision of a new communal room for community activity and was completed in just eight months. Two new dwellings were built as well. Four of the original houses had been empty and as a result six families from the Dublin City Council housing waiting list have been allocated homes."

"Greenlawns was built in 1986 on land donated by the local parish in Bonnybrook and funded by the Coolock-Artane Credit Union. It was the first development of its kind in the country and proven to be a very successful example of the housing co-operative model. Tenants becoming shareholders in the co-operative, entitling them to vote on how their estate operates."
